What is a Sole Proprietorship?

A sole proprietorship is a business structure where there is no legal distinction between the owner and the business. The proprietor enjoys full authority over operations, decision-making, and profits. However, this also means that the owner bears unlimited liability for all business obligations.

Depending on the nature and location of the business, registrations such as GST, MSME (Udyam), and Shop & Establishment licenses may be required. This structure is best suited for low-risk businesses operating on a small or medium scale.

Understanding Sole Proprietorship Registration

Sole proprietorship registration is the process of legally establishing a business owned by a single individual. While formal incorporation under the Companies Act is not mandatory, certain registrations and licenses are required to operate legally.

Since the proprietor and business are treated as the same entity, all profits, losses, and liabilities are directly linked to the owner. Businesses may require GST registration, Shop & Establishment registration, or sector-specific licenses depending on turnover and activities.

Advantages of Sole Proprietorship Registration

1. Easy Formation with Minimal Compliance

A sole proprietorship is easy to start, affordable, and involves fewer legal formalities compared to LLPs or private limited companies.

2. Complete Ownership and Quick Decisions

The proprietor has full control over the business, enabling faster decisions without external approvals—perfect for small business owners and service providers.

3. Tax Efficiency

Income is taxed as personal income, which can help reduce tax burden. Eligible proprietors may also claim deductions and benefits under applicable tax laws.

4. Direct Customer Interaction

Sole proprietors can build strong, personal relationships with customers, improving trust and service quality—especially beneficial for local and service-based businesses.

5. Flexible Workforce Management

Proprietors can hire employees or engage consultants as required while retaining complete control over operations and finances.

Limitations and Key Considerations

1. Regulatory Requirements

Certain businesses must obtain specific licenses such as FSSAI, GST, or Shop & Establishment registration based on operations.

2. Limited Funding Options

Due to its informal structure, raising external capital or attracting investors can be challenging.

3. No Perpetual Existence

The business may cease in case of the proprietor’s death or incapacity.

4. Lower Market Credibility

Lack of formal incorporation may impact credibility when dealing with large clients or institutions.

Eligibility Criteria

To register a sole proprietorship in India, the applicant must:

  • Be at least 18 years old

  • Be an Indian citizen

  • Have legal capacity to enter contracts

  • Not be bankrupt or convicted of serious offences

  • Carry out lawful business activities

  • Use a unique business name

Documents Required

Personal Documents

  • Aadhaar Card

  • PAN Card

Business Details

  • Business bank account details

  • Address proof (utility bill / rent agreement / sale deed)

  • NOC from landlord (if rented)

Registrations (if applicable)

  • GST Certificate

  • MSME (Udyam) Certificate

  • Shop & Establishment License

Note: Requirements may vary by state and business type.
